Task 2 Topic: Should governments regulate the use of artificial intelligence?


Model Answer Title: A Balanced Approach to Regulating Artificial Intelligence

In today's rapidly advancing world, the role of technology has become increasingly significant. One such breakthrough is artificial intelligence (AI), which has the potential to revolutionize numerous industries and aspects of life. However, this raises questions about whether governments should regulate AI usage. While there are valid arguments for both sides, a balanced approach that combines regulation with ethical considerations is crucial to ensuring the responsible development and application of AI.

On one hand, it can be argued that AI has the potential to bring about numerous benefits. For instance, in healthcare, AI-driven diagnostic tools can help identify diseases at an early stage, ultimately saving lives. In agriculture, precision farming techniques enabled by AI can optimize resource usage and reduce environmental impact. Furthermore, AI can streamline processes across various sectors, increasing efficiency and productivity.

On the other hand, there are potential risks associated with AI that need to be addressed. For example, the development of advanced AI systems may lead to job displacement in certain industries, causing unemployment and social unrest. Additionally, AI algorithms can perpetuate biases present in training data, resulting in unfair treatment of certain groups. Lastly, privacy concerns are raised due to AI's ability to analyze vast amounts of personal data.

Taking both perspectives into account, it is clear that governments should play a role in regulating the use of AI, but not at the expense of innovation. They can establish guidelines to ensure ethical AI development and usage while fostering an environment conducive to innovation. This approach would involve creating frameworks for responsible AI implementation, setting standards for data protection and privacy, and promoting transparency and accountability in AI systems.

In conclusion, governments should not shy away from regulating the use of artificial intelligence. Instead, they must adopt a balanced approach that encourages responsible development while minimizing potential risks. By doing so, they can help harness the transformative power of AI for the betterment of society as a whole.

Overall Score: Band 8.5

Task Achievement: The candidate has provided a well-structured and coherent answer to the question, with relevant examples and arguments from both perspectives. They have also proposed a solution that considers both innovation and regulation. (Band 9)

Coherence and Cohesion: The response is logically organized, with each paragraph flowing seamlessly into the next. The candidate has used appropriate cohesive devices to connect ideas within and between sentences, ensuring a smooth reading experience. (Band 9)

Lexical Resource: The candidate's vocabulary is sophisticated and varied, demonstrating a strong command of English. They have employed a mix of complex words and phrases, which add depth and nuance to their argument. (Band 8.5)

Grammatical Range and Accuracy: The candidate's grammar is mostly accurate and advanced. There are only a few minor errors that do not significantly affect the overall meaning or flow of the essay. (Band 8.5)
